Changelog
- 03efb93 Add audit middleware to services (#2006)
- fd918a5 Add gcp big query model adapter (#2093)
- 6c531e5 Add gcp spanner database adapter (#2065)
- e8998f3 Add google cloud spanner instance adapter (#2049)
- 076285a Add sourceMetadata and manager options for gcp sources (#2103)
- 7a8017f Address lambda-function adapter hanging in infinite loop (#2040)
- 8c584c6 Address mapstructure vulnerability by updating go.mod (#2041)
- c3bcd03 ENG-481: Add change checklist into Frontend (#1771)
- 398d699 Eng 519 use linker in manual adapters (#1695)
- 719e83d Eng 523 centralise integration tests (#2024)
- e5fc5ee Eng 533 wire dynamic adapters to gcp source initialisation (#1768)
- 9993528 Eng 573 add adapter meta for the following item types final batch (#1806)
- 77bdb28 Eng 580 handle terraform mappings in dynamic adapters (#2017)
- a890343 Eng 582 support search in dynamic adapters (#1877)
- 5ffc579 Eng 611 create a specific permissions list for gcp source (#2098)
- 994ec5c Eng 705 support linking to parent resource (#2033)
- a97ade4 Eng 716 add unit test framework for gcp dynamic adapters (#2011)
- a697d9f Eng 727 aws source adapters should not fail validation (#2004)
- 4e53134 Ensure that potentially long-running IAM queries abort on context errors (#2009)
- cc5d447 Feat/gcp compute dynamic api blast propagation (#1775)
- d96d1a3 Fix mapping for elb rules (#2132)
- 4dc1a2b Move from Attio to Hubspot (#1673)
- 3a576a8 Nauany/crypto key (#1627)
- 8890e86 Nauany/disk adapter (#1357)
- 97329f3 Nauany/key ring adapter (#1656)
- 19b6578 Only show the first 3 "previous values" for diffs (#1675)
- 3c79630 Recover and report panics during autotagging (#2053)
- 7903ca3 Refactor feature flagging code (#1866)
- 0919ece This missing link was noticed by Deliveroo (#1986)
- 6752a2e Updated all links to a much more recent demo video (#1977)
- 49598c6 add terraform mappings (#1828)
- 2ba76d0 build gcp source image (#2165)
- 3838c31 centralise gcp dynamic adapter creation (#2087)
- b12da81 chore(deps): update alpine docker tag to v3.22 (#1747)
- 74b34af chore(deps): update terraform (#1597)
- cf1334d chore(deps): update terraform (#1869)
- d594813 chore, remove change timeline v1 (#1690)
- 4002b43 chore, remove playground from backend (#1973)
- 7ade53e chore: ensure matching get query param with unique attribute for gcp SA (#1984)
- bcced1a chore: remove duplicate type definitions in gcp manual adapters (#1981)
- 727046a feat, SDP add change validation (#1644)
- 7755a8d feat, api-server all_modifications table and insert on change done (#2018)
- 345ec35 feat, initial commit of signals to SDP. simple storage, aggregation of signals and caching (#2181)
- f7702fc feat: add adapter for service-account-key (#1687)
- 4875e5b feat: add blast propagation and manual adapter links for gcp source (#1672)
- bd9bdb4 feat: add blast propagations for apiplatform/logging and iam role (#1891)
- ed3c6c1 feat: add blast propagations for pubsub, sqladmin and run api item types (#1907)
- ca1a6aa feat: add blast propagations for the final batch of first milestone (#1915)
- c645f40 feat: add compute machine image adapter (#1447)
- 3f00c4c feat: add dynamic adapters for gcp source (#1732)
- 3b6beb1 feat: add gcp bigquery dataset manual adapter (#1898)
- 4fdf53b feat: add gcp bigquery table manual adapter (#1911)
- fe8d5bd feat: add gcp logging sink adapter (#1922)
- 87644c0 feat: add linker for dynamic gcp adapters (#1684)
- bda1ea9 feat: add new adapter meta to gcp dynamic adapters (#1794)
- 0a03cb5 feat: add snapshot adapter (#1413)
- 02d9275 feat: manage token via gcp GO SDK for gcp dynamic adapters (#1978)
- 2067906 feat: support custom search method description in gcp dynamic adapters (#2051)
- b3e5d49 feat: support listable and searchable adapter in dynamic adapters (#1923)
- 02e186f feat: support logging api in gcp dynamic adapters (#1833)
- a3cd31d feat: support pagination in gcp dynamic adapters (#2058)
- 8924b34 feat: support streaming in dynamic gcp adapters (#2069)
- 651f106 feat: support terraform query map via id in gcp manual adapters (#1992)
- 377bb7a feat: use explicit blast propagations and revert back to manual linking in the compute instance (#1864)
- b55d7ab fix(deps): update module github.com/charmbracelet/lipgloss to v2 (#2085)
- 5562955 fix, api-server - remove risk analysis steps (#1791)
- 200aeaf fix, api-server change validation hidden behind posthog (#1654)
- 94ddefd fix, aws-source iam nil pointer (#1902)
- 1d2f9bf fix, aws-source unit tests throw appropriate skip warnings in CI (#2102)
- 0e2e20a fix, remove UpdatePlannedChanges in favor of StartChangeAnalysis (#1591)
- 2f543d3 fix, remove summary flag from cli (#1528)
- b3d09bb fix-tracing: use custom nats header carrier for otel (#2149)
- 004a74d fix: an endpoint in gcp dynamic adapters and improving error logging (#1887)
- 75b3206 fix: ensure to use the GET query param as the unique attribute value in gcp manual adapters (#1976)
- 6427d14 refactor: prepare gcp sources directory for dynamic adapters (#1677)
- f22fbae security, cli. remove traces of lost-pixel (#1895)
- ffadb71 service account adapter - box integration (#1685)
- e07d06a use explicit blast propagation in dynamic adapters (#1852)